I can't find any documentation that defines what a web page is in Marketo. For example, when someone stays on a page for +10 seconds, The would qualify as a visit? I saw that a session is 30 minutes in Marketo, but I am not certain those are the same things. Any additional info would help, as we are trying to track and apply lead scoring to certain pages on our website, but the numbers aren't making a whole lot of sense.

Visited Web Page is a single pageview logged by Marketo’s Munchkin analytics JS.

 

It does not relate to how long the person was on the page, nor to a multi-page session. (Marketo doesn’t mark sessions by 30-minute periods, don’t know where you could have gotten that info.)
